Cedar City Regional Airport is a full-service airport, centrally located to serve three National Parks, two National Monuments, two ski resorts and acres of pristine recreational areas.
Positioned within two miles of downtown Cedar City, Utah, the airport provides quick access to the many events and activities taking place in Cedar City such as the Utah Summer Games, the Utah Shakespearean Festival and sporting events at Southern Utah University
